WebJan 19, 2024 · Intuit creates the Form 1099-K as per instructions by the IRS and reports the amount of gross sales before any adjustments. Gross amount refers to the total dollar amount of all reportable payment transactions, without regard to any adjustments for credits, cash equivalents, discount amounts, fees, refunded amounts, or any other amounts. WebMay 16, 2024 · If your lender agreed to accept less than you owe for a debt, you might get a Form 1099-C in the mail. Alternatively, your lender might automatically discharge the debt and send you a Form 1099-C if it’s decided to stop trying to collect the debt from you. While lenders are only required to send 1099-Cs if a canceled debt is worth $600 or ... WebYou settle a debt with a creditor who agrees to forgive $8,500. You do not have to report any of that money as income on your tax return. Example 2: Your assets are worth $35,000 and your debts still total $45,000, but the creditor writes off a $14,000 debt.
